site stats

Forward algorithm vs viterbi

WebNov 21, 2024 · The Viterbi algorithm and the Forward-Backward (i.e., Baum-Welch) algorithm are computing different things. The Viterbi algorithm only finds the single most likely path, and its corresponding probability (which can then be used as a good approximation of the total Forward probability that the model generated the given … WebDec 14, 2009 · The Forward-Backward algorithm combines the forward step and the backward step to get the probability of being at each state at a specific time. Doing …

HMM#:#Viterbi#algorithm#1 atoyexample - University of …

WebIn this section, we introduce algorithms known as the forward algorithm, backward algorithm, Viterbi algorithm and Baum–Welch algorithm. Either forward or backward algorithms [12,13] can be used for Problem (i), while both of these algorithms are used in the Baum–Welch algorithm for Problem (iii). The Viterbi algorithm ([15,16]) solves ... WebThe algorithm uses dynamic programming, and requires that the symbol sequence be preceded and terminated by known symbols (of length L-1, where L is the FIR channel length). Fig. 2 illustrates the Fig. 3: SVM training Viterbi algorithm on a BPSK symbol set and an FIR channel of length L=2. javascript programiz online https://multisarana.net

Viterbi algorithm - Species and Gene Evolution

WebJul 15, 2024 · Viterbi Algorithm For finding the most probable sequence of hidden states, we use max-sum algorithm known as Viterbi algorithm for HMMs. It searches the space of paths (possible sequences) efficiently with a computational cost … WebHMMs, including the key unsupervised learning algorithm for HMM, the Forward-Backward algorithm. We’ll repeat some of the text from Chapter 8 for readers who want the whole … WebThen, for instance, the (iterative) Viterbi estimate of the transition probabilities are given as follows: Pe(S k+1 = a;S k= b) = @ [F 1()]j!0: (12) Conditional probabilities for observations are calculated similarly via a different indicator function. 4 Generating Function Note from (4) that both P(x) and P^(x) are obtained as matrix-products. javascript print image from url

machine learning - Hidden Markov Model and Viterbi algorithm ...

Category:Forward algorithm - Wikipedia

Tags:Forward algorithm vs viterbi

Forward algorithm vs viterbi

(PDF) Communication Channel Equalization- Pattern Recognition …

WebNov 21, 2024 · The Viterbi algorithm and the Forward-Backward (i.e., Baum-Welch) algorithm are computing different things. The Viterbi algorithm only finds the single …

Forward algorithm vs viterbi

Did you know?

WebThe example below implements the forward algorithm in log space to compute the partition function, and the viterbi algorithm to decode. Backpropagation will compute the gradients automatically for us. We don’t have to do anything by hand. The implementation is not optimized. If you understand what is going on, you’ll probably quickly see ... WebCourse Websites The Grainger College of Engineering UIUC

Web• Solution -Forward Algorithm and Viterbi Algorithm Decoding: • Problem - Find state sequence which maximizes probability of observation sequence • Solution -Viterbi Algorithm Training: • Problem - Adjust model parameters to maximize probability of observed sequences • Solution -Forward-Backward Algorithm. 12 Evaluation … WebApr 4, 2024 · The Viterbi algorithm calculates the single path with the highest likelihood to produce a specific observation sequence. Pomegranate provides the HMM.viterbi () …

WebJan 31, 2024 · The Forward-Backward Algorithm Let’s get technical for a minute. The Viterbi algorithm doesn’t just “decode the observations”. It solves a very specific math problem: given a sequence o¹o²… of … WebThe Viterbi algorithm in “log-space” ... Forward algorithm using scaled values We can modify the forward-recursion to use scaled values In step n compute and store temporarily the K values δ(z n1

WebDec 29, 2024 · With X X the vector of hidden random variables and Y Y the vector of observed random variables, viterbi gives you the Maximum A Posteriori (MAP) estimate defined by: x x ^ M A P = a r g m a x x x p ( X X = x x Y Y = y y). On the other hand, posterior gives you the estimate of each marginal probability. If you take locally the …

http://www.adeveloperdiary.com/data-science/machine-learning/forward-and-backward-algorithm-in-hidden-markov-model/ javascript pptx to htmlWebDec 6, 2015 · Viterbi algorithm is a dynamic programming algorithm for finding the most probable sequence of hidden states given a sequence of observations in an HMM. The table in your solution has one row per hidden state (O, F, B) and one column per observation ( ∅, head, head) where ∅ denotes the beginning of the observation sequence. javascript progress bar animationWebCompute the log probability under the model and compute posteriors. Implements rank and beam pruning in the forward-backward algorithm to speed up inference in large models. Sequence of n_features-dimensional data points. Each row … javascript programs in javatpointWebThe Forward algorithm and Viterbi are different algorithms with different purposes. Filtering. The Forward algorithm (in the context of a Hidden Markov Model) is used to … javascript programsWeb1. Finding the most likely trajectory. Given a HMM and a sequence of observables: x1,x2,…,xL. determine the most likely sequence of states that generated x1,x2,…,xL: … javascript print object as jsonWebFeb 17, 2024 · There are two such algorithms, Forward Algorithm and Backward Algorithm. Forward Algorithm: In Forward Algorithm (as … javascript projects for portfolio redditWebDec 17, 2014 · In particular, the Viterbi algorithm provides a pointwise estimate in that it requires knowledge of the model parameters $\theta$ (usually estimated from the data as ${\hat \theta}$, for example using the EM algorithm, or Baum-Welch for HMM) and in that it provides a single best estimate for the most likely state rather some posterior distribution. javascript powerpoint